Output 189a42564d85542d37770766ccf49c695c76cb61bfd40fa7b9eee2806cffeb07:16

value
306996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e70319bca29e8cf25a43b0b3a343642bc25c7a2c OP_EQUAL
address
3NkVjHWgMe2Brh1C8Fk3pUGyMzaMKMSZpX
transaction
189a42564d85542d37770766ccf49c695c76cb61bfd40fa7b9eee2806cffeb07
spent
true